Decision Science Analyst

The Decision Science Analyst will architect the analytical foundation of Red Robin's Growth, Intelligence & Decisioning capability. Equal parts data miner, performance analyst, model builder, and strategic thought partner, this role will build the analytical frameworks, measurement methodologies, and decision support infrastructure leadership relies on to understand performance and optimize business outcomes.

This role will provide ongoing support and performance visibility across Marketing, Loyalty, CRM, Paid Media, Culinary, Pricing, Customer Experience, and First Choice initiatives and will be responsible for connecting customer, transaction, menu, pricing, media, digital, and operational data to drive enterprise decision making.

The Decision Science Analyst will help build analytical capabilities for Red Robin, leveraging data from customer platforms, engagement platforms, digital commerce platforms, enterprise data environments, customer experience platforms, and intelligence platforms to create actionable insights and recommendations.

This position will both build something new while supporting critical initiatives such as First Choice segmentation, pricing strategy, menu innovation, customer growth, loyalty optimization, media effectiveness, and hyper local marketing approaches. Success requires a builder mindset and comfort operating in an environment where analytical frameworks, measurement standards, and decision support capabilities are actively being developed.

The role will partner closely with internal stakeholders including Marketing, Culinary, Pricing, Finance, Customer Experience, Operations, and Executive Leadership, while also collaborating with external partners including Analytica, Surface, media agencies, and strategic analytical partners supporting growth initiatives and customer decisioning.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
